CSTV Serves Up "Tailgate Superstars"

The 24 hour power in college sports introduces its broadband streaming of a hot, new fan-centric show hosted by VJ beauty, Marianela, and red carpet fashion guru, Leon Hall.

CSTV Staff Report

On October 6th, CSTV (the 24 hour power in college sports) kicked off its broadband streaming of Tailgate Superstars, a hot new fan-centric show hosted by VJ beauty, Marianela, and red carpet fashion guru, Leon Hall.

The show pilot, at the Florida - LSU game, features the best of college football fans in their element, the tailgate party. Although the show was a little one sided (LSU fans won't mind) it was nice to see how serious and creative tailgaters really are. Whether it was fried alligator or motorized coolers, the tailgaters were strutting their stuff while CSTV caught all the action on film.

"There's no TRW (The Real World) drama here. This is all about the fans and the outrageous fun and traditions that happen in the lots at these games," Lynn Thomlison, co-creator of the show, said. "For once the fans are the stars not the athletes - it's a tribute their loyalty and passion for the game."

CSTV has 2 more games planned for its short first season. This Saturday the TSS crew will be on the lot at Penn State as it faces No. 1 Ohio State. In three weeks CSTV plans to cover the elegant side of tailgating at Mississippi as the Rebels play host to LSU.
